The Euclid Board of Control on June 23 approved an $8,550 requisition from the Community Development Block Grant fund to Infinity Home Services to pay for a roofing assistance grant for a city resident.

The action, presented during the Board of Control meeting at Euclid City Hall, was described as a roofing assistance grant and noted that the resident is also using the Edcor home improvement loan program. Board members voted verbally in favor; the clerk called for the question and the group responded "Aye."

The requisition was described by meeting staff as drawn from the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) fund. No additional details about the homeowner, the property address, or the timing for work were stated on the record.

Board members did not ask follow-up questions during the discussion, and the motion was approved without further comment. The record does not list individual roll-call votes for this item.
